MNZ said:
BTW it appears from the post I read about OEM genericly branded mini's that the no brand I bought, the Rutoo and potentially the Janty Yentl all come out of the same factory, this may also be the case for a number of other branded mini's

That's pretty much it. From what I can gather there are a small handful of factories who have liscence to manufacture units under the original patents from Ruyan. They produce a lot of generic models and some sellers are just reselling those unbranded. Others are produced in the same generic batches, but are packaged for a brand, like SmartFixx, etc. Others are produced to order for a brand using their own design and engineering specifications, like njoy and Janty.

So it's still just a handful of factories, and some factories are better than others, but even from the same factory, there can be big differences in the products made for each brand.
